Dan most tracks around here are right around sealevel 50-100' above. So sometimes, in the winter months we get negative DA's in the -1,000' to -1,800'. I have never been able to take advantage of these kind of conditions but it makes for some awesome runs for those who do. It doesn't get very cold down south so the tracks only close for about 4-5weeks in December. Later Clint
